At Saxmundham train station, efficiency meets simplicity. Though there isn't a traditional ticket office, ticket machines are readily available for collecting tickets purchased online, making it straightforward and convenient to start your trip. These machines are designed to be accessible, though they only accept card payments. The station also accommodates passengers with hearing impairments with readily available induction loops.
While visiting, you'll notice the station's commitment to accessibility. There is step-free access to both platforms from Station Approach, aligned with its classification as a category B1 station. Despite the absence of wheelchair availability and accessible toilets, the station offers ramps for train access. CCTV operates throughout to ensure passenger safety.

Wembley Stadium Train Station provides essential amenities to ensure a stress-free journey. While the station does not have a ticket office, 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ting pre-booked tickets, with accessible options and an induction loop for ease of use. Customer assistance is readily accessible through help points, and CCTV assures an added layer of security.
However, travelers should plan for minimal facilities on-site—there are no public toilets, waiting lounges, refreshment outlets, or bicycle storage facilities. Despite these limitations, the station ensures step-free access to all platforms, albeit with some distance between them.
While there are no direct rail replacement buses due to road access issues, passengers can organize alternative transport via station help points.
